Palm-lined backwaters reflect quiet villages where fishing nets rise at dawn, temple lamps glow in the early light, and the air carries the scent of rain-soaked earth, coconut, and incense.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Travel in Kerala is never hurried; it unfolds gradually, like a story whispered rather than announced.<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Kathakali and Mohiniyattam performances echo myth and devotion, while village markets hum with the spice trade that once drew the world to these shores.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>Festival: Vishu<\/b><\/h3>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img fetchpriority=\"high\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-4835 al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/vishu-in-kerala.webp\" alt=\"Vishu Festival in Kerala\" width=\"956\" height=\"438\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/vishu-in-kerala.webp 1200w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/vishu-in-kerala-300x138.webp 300w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/vishu-in-kerala-1024x469.webp 1024w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/vishu-in-kerala-768x352.webp 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 956px) 100vw, 956px\" \/><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Vishu, the Malayalam New Year celebrated in April, marks renewal, prosperity, and the start of the agricultural cycle. The day begins before sunrise with <b>Vishu Kani<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, the sacred first sight, golden konna flowers, rice, fruits, coins, mirrors, and oil lamps, believed to influence the year ahead.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Celebrations continue with the <b>Vishu Sadhya<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, an elaborate vegetarian feast served on banana leaves, followed by fireworks that light up village skies in a blend of devotion, joy, and family togetherness.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>Best Things to Do<\/b><\/h3>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cruise through the backwaters of Alleppey and Kumarakom on a traditional houseboat<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Experience Vishu rituals in temples and local homes<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Wander through Munnar\u2019s mist-laden tea gardens<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Relax on the cliffside beaches of Varkala<\/span><\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>2. Travel here is immersive and heartfelt, shared through meals, stories, and music that linger long after the journey ends.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>Festival: Baisakhi<br \/>\n<img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-4836 al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/baisakhi-of-punjab.webp\" alt=\"Baisakhi of Punjab\" width=\"930\" height=\"426\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/baisakhi-of-punjab.webp 1200w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/baisakhi-of-punjab-300x138.webp 300w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/baisakhi-of-punjab-1024x469.webp 1024w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/baisakhi-of-punjab-768x352.webp 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 930px) 100vw, 930px\" \/><br \/>\n<\/b><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Celebrated in April, <b>Baisakhi<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> marks the harvest festival and Sikh New Year, commemorating the formation of the Khalsa in 1699. Fields turn festive, gurudwaras resonate with kirtan, and massive <\/span><b>langars<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> serve free meals to all. <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Village squares fill with <\/span><b>bhangra and gidda<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, capturing Punjab at its most joyful, generous, and proud.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>Best Things to Do<\/b><\/h3>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Visit the Golden Temple in Amritsar at sunrise<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Witness the Wagah Border Retreat Ceremony<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Explore the Partition Museum<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Enjoy authentic Punjabi cuisine and folk performances<\/span><\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Explore <a href=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/packages\/golden-triangle-with-amritsar-tour-8-days-7-nights\">Golden Triangle with Amritsar Tour our 8 Days 7 Nights Tour Package<\/a>.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>3. Travel in Maharashtra during the New Year season offers an intimate look at how heritage, faith, and community continue to shape daily life.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>Festival: Gudi Padwa<\/b><\/h3>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b><br \/>\n<img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-4837 al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/gudi-padwa-maharastra.webp\" alt=\"Gudi Padwa\" width=\"896\" height=\"411\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/gudi-padwa-maharastra.webp 1200w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/gudi-padwa-maharastra-300x138.webp 300w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/gudi-padwa-maharastra-1024x469.webp 1024w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/gudi-padwa-maharastra-768x352.webp 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 896px) 100vw, 896px\" \/><br \/>\n<\/b><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Celebrated in March or April, <b>Gudi Padwa<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> marks the Marathi New Year and the beginning of a new harvest cycle. The festival takes its name from the <\/span><b>Gudi<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, a bamboo pole adorned with bright silk cloth, neem leaves, fresh flowers, and topped with an inverted copper or silver pot. Raised outside homes, the Gudi symbolises victory, prosperity, protection, and good fortune for the year ahead.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Families come together to prepare traditional dishes that carefully balance sweet and bitter flavours, most notably neem leaves mixed with jaggery, an edible reminder that life is made of contrasting experiences, both to be accepted with grace.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Best Things to Do<\/strong><\/h3>\n<ul style=\"text-align: left;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Walk through old Pune during Gudi Padwa<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Visit Siddhivinayak Temple or Shaniwar Wada<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Taste puran poli and neem-jaggery preparations<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Explore heritage markets in Mumbai and Pune<\/span><\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/packages\/explore-maharashtra-4-days-3-nights\">Explore Maharashtra<\/a> our 4 Days 3 Nights Tour Package.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>5. Towns and villages feel freshly awakened, homes are decorated with mango leaves and rangoli, and conversations turn toward new beginnings.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b>Festival: Ugadi<\/b><\/h3>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><b><br \/>\n<img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-4839 al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/ugadi-andhra-pradesh.webp\" alt=\"Ugadi Festival\" width=\"904\" height=\"414\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/ugadi-andhra-pradesh.webp 1200w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/ugadi-andhra-pradesh-300x138.webp 300w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/ugadi-andhra-pradesh-1024x469.webp 1024w, https:\/\/www.cholantours.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/ugadi-andhra-pradesh-768x352.webp 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 904px) 100vw, 904px\" \/><br \/>\n<\/b><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><b>Ugadi<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, the Telugu New Year, marks the beginning of the <\/span><b>Chaitra<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> month and the arrival of spring. The day traditionally begins with early morning oil baths and temple visits, setting a tone of purity and intention. Central to the celebration is <\/span><b>Ugadi Pachadi<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, a symbolic dish that combines sweet, sour, bitter, salty, spicy, and tangy flavours, each representing a different experience of life and teaching acceptance of both joy and hardship.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Homes and temples host <b>Panchanga Sravanam<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, the ceremonial reading of astrological forecasts that offer insight into the year ahead. These readings connect individuals to cosmic rhythms and reinforce themes of wisdom, balance, and conscious living.
